Craving Siberia? Grab a Can!

That brutal Siberian wind got you feeling dampened? Well, fret no more! You've got the perfect solution to relocate you straight to the spirit of Siberia without ever leaving your couch. Just grab a can of their special Siberian soda, and in a single sip, you'll be feeling the chill on your skin. Visualize yourself standing amidst frozen landsca

read more